Tracked Vehicle Product Manager - Development

The Domestic Tracked Product Manager - Development is a leadership position responsible for training, development, organization, direction, and guidance to employees executing our legacy vehicle development. The portfolio consists of current domestic vehicle platform engineering development projects. The candidate will lead and manage a team of engineers in roles such as product managers, project leads, and chief engineers.

Company Information:

General Dynamics is a Fortune 100, global aerospace and defense company with over 90,000 employees worldwide. General Dynamics Land Systems delivers core engineering and manufacturing capabilities for military vehicles, focusing on continuous improvement to reduce costs and enhance safety. We work with the US Armed Forces and Allies to maintain vehicle relevance and capability in dynamic threat environments.

Responsibilities:

  • Train and develop direct reports
  • Manage departmental workload and performance actions
  • Work with program office, manufacturing, QA/SQA, and SCM to resolve production issues
  • Represent the department to GDLS leadership and customers
  • Review and approve engineering bids within the portfolio
  • Conduct performance management activities
  • Provide guidance in:
    • Executing project plans and schedules
    • Establishing funding mechanisms
    • Maintaining project manpower demand
  • Utilize problem reporting metrics to monitor project performance
  • Lead engineering RCCA activities for production issues
  • Communicate direction to stakeholders delivering technical products
  • Other duties as assigned

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ering (Mechanical, Electrical, Systems preferred)
  • MBA/MS a plus
  • Minimum of 10 years relevant experience
  • Project Management experience required
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ective customer relationships
  • Experience leading teams
  • Experience in complex systems design and integration
  • Proven leadership skills
  • Ability to assess technical risk and develop mitigation plans
  • Excellent analytical, planning, and problem-solving skills
  • Strong oral and written communication skills
  • Excellent business acumen and negotiating skills
  • Ability to travel as needed
